### Account Recovery — Catalogue Import (Lintwood)

Quick one for review: when the Lintwood catalogue import wipes a patron's session table, the recovery flow re-seeds accounts from the nightly snapshot. Check that the importer skips locked accounts — last time it didn't. To rerun recovery against staging you'll need the vault passphrase, which is appended just below.

recovery phrase for yafof-tajof: julmir-kelax-julvan-holath-belvan-holir-ralael-ralvan-ralath-julvan-silmir-istmir-kaswyn-ulamir

Subject: Key rotation — Ordervault

Maintainers: rotating the Ordervault service key this week. Context for the future: the orders table uses soft deletes — rows get a deleted_at stamp, never dropped — so the reconciliation endpoint must keep its read scope over tombstoned rows, which is why the rotated key carries the same grants. Old key dies Monday. New internal key for Ordervault is below.

API key for yahig-tadup: kto7_ubizbYm

Three candidates in the Merrow Basin region have passed initial screening; pilot orders begin next month. Expect dual-sourcing to add modest unit cost initially, offset by reduced expedite fees. Do not alter current Varnholt orders, and keep this search out of supplier conversations. Onboarding timelines will be circulated after pilot results. Strategic context follows in the confidential note below.

confidential, kagup-bafog: Fraaxax Group is in early talks to buy Soroxox Group for about $343.8 million. The Olidor launch date is June 14, and nothing goes to the press before then. Legal wants the Aldmirek Logistics term sheet signed before July 23.

## Formula sandbox tuning

User-supplied formulas in Gridmoor execute inside a restricted interpreter with hard ceilings on time, memory, and call depth. Reviewers should confirm any change to these ceilings is justified in the PR description, since raising them widens the abuse surface. Defaults were chosen from production traces. The current limits are as follows.

limits module of tafog-fawip:
WEIGHTS = {
    "julix": 57,
    "lamys": 992,
    "kasvan": 209,
    "quenok": 750,
    "alddor": 259,
    "oliath": 1009,
    "wenix": 815,
}